Title | Grey, Thomas de 6th Baron Walsingham: certificate of election to the Royal Society |
Description | Note at foot of certificate: 'Addenda - See over'. Addenda to citation appear on reverse of certificate |
Citation | Trustee of the British Museum, a practical Entomologist and ardent student and collector of the Microlepidoptera, of which he has an extensive private collection. In 1872 Lord Walsingham made a special expedition to Northern California and Oregon and besides forming a large series of the Misrolepidoptera of that district - many of which were unknown - obtained a good collection of other Natural History specimens which he presented to the Cambridge Museum. |
Addenda (1887) - Dr Gunther Author of - Catalogue of North American Tortricidae in the British Museum. 4to being Part IV of "Illustrations of typical specimens of Lepidopera Heterocera" 1879. Published by the writers On some probable causes of a tendency to melanic variation in Lepidoptera of high latitudes (Presidential address) Trans Yorkshire Naturalists Union, 1885 And various papers in the Transactions of the Entomological Society and Proceedings of the Zoological Society (1880-84) |
Proposers | From General Knowledge: Richard Owen From Personal Knowledge: P L Sclater; Osbert Salvin; Walden; Robert Hudson; H T Stainton; Alfred Newton; A Gunther; R McLachlan; J Fayrer; W H Flower; St George Mivart; Henry Woodward; J A Grant Lt Col |
